Abstract
In the field of dental medicine science, one of the frequently
and oldest used techniques for detecting teeth periapical
lesions disease is X-Ray. It is important to analysis the dental
x-ray images to extract features of image. The process of
analysing X-Ray images is important to improve quantifies
medical imaging systems. In this paper we present a
technique for dental x-ray images segmentation and feature
extraction. The proposed technique has been implemented by
using expectation maximization (EM) technique for
segmentation after image enhancement and remove noise.
The extracted features techniques can use to obtain the teeth
measurements for automatic dental systems such as dental
diagnosis systems. The experimental result show the
importance of the proposed technique to extract teeth features
from an X-Ray image.
